How much does it cost to live in Greifswald?

A single resident of Greifswald spends roughly €1,700 per month, with a one-bedroom rent near €905. Overall the city is around average cost for Germany. These are modelled estimates, not live quotes — verify locally.

What is the climate like in Greifswald?

Greifswald has a humid continental climate, averaging about 5.4°C annually with roughly 721 mm of rain. The hottest month is Jul and the coldest Jan. The driest is typically Jan.
